About

Dr. Anita Gottipati is a distinguished Neurologist in Cleveland, TX. Dr. Gottipati specializes in diagnosing, treating, and managing disorders of the brain and nervous system. With expertise in handling complex conditions like epilepsy, multiple sclerosis, and migraines, Dr. Gottipati employs advanced techniques and personalized treatment plans to improve patient outcomes. As a neurologist, Dr. Gottipati is committed to staying abreast of the latest developments in neurological research and therapies.
